Global Take Off: Puerto Rico

2016

Global Take Off Puerto Rico is a fully funded, interactive, five-day, faculty-led experience held after final exams are over in December. In collaboration with the Institute for the Study of the Americas and the Sonja H. Stone Center for Black Culture and History, the 2016 program included the following components:

  • Fully funded trip to Puerto Rico to participate in an interactive educational experience, including discussions with Puerto Rican students and community members and tours of local sites and attractions;
  • Collaborative learning with both UNC and University of Puerto Rico faculty and staff; and
  • Career and personal development and networking opportunities.

The 2016 program theme was food sustainability and autonomy.
